Цэцулеску, Александр Иванович
Summary
Цэцулеску, Александр Иванович is a human[1]. His place of birth was Bucharest[2]. He was born on +1916-01-07T00:00:00Z[3]. He died in Mytishchi[4]. He died on +2011-02-12T00:00:00Z[5]. He worked as a gynecologist[6], radiologist[7], military physician[8], university teacher[9], and oncologist[10].

Body
Origins and Family
Цэцулеску, Александр Иванович was born in Bucharest[2]. He was born on +1916-01-07T00:00:00Z[3].
Education
Educated at Carol Davila University of Medicine and Pharmacy[21], a university[27], in Romania[28], founded in 1857[29], headquartered in Bucharest[30] and Russian Medical Postgraduate Academy[22], a medical school[31], in Russia[32], founded in 1930[33]. Цэцулеску, Александр Иванович's doctoral advisor was Samuil Aronovich Rheinberg[23]. Academic degrees include Doctor of Sciences in Medicine[34] and Candidate of Sciences in Medicine[35].
Career and Affiliations
Recorded occupations include gynecologist[6], radiologist[7], military physician[8], university teacher[9], and oncologist[10]. Fields of work include radiology[16], a medical specialty[36]; oncology[17], a medical specialty[37]; and gynaecology[18], a medical specialty[38]. Employers include Nicolae Testemițanu State University of Medicine and Pharmacy[19], a university[39], in Moldova[40], founded in 1944[41] and Tver State Medical Academy[20], a university[42], in Russia[43], founded in 1954[44].
Recognition
Awards received include National Order of Faithful Service[24], an order[45], in Romania[46], founded in 1932[47] and Badge "Excellence in Healthcare of the USSR"[25], a badge of distinction[48], in Soviet Union[49], founded in 1956[50].
Death and Burial
Цэцулеску, Александр Иванович died on +2011-02-12T00:00:00Z[5]. He passed away in Mytishchi[4]. He is buried at Ghencea Cemetery[11].
